About A. Dybbs
A. Dybbs is a scholar working on Computational Mechanics, Mechanical Engineering, Ocean Engineering, Biomedical Engineering and Mechanics of Materials, having authored 25 papers that have together received 408 indexed citations. Recurring topics across this work include Heat and Mass Transfer in Porous Media (8 papers), Lattice Boltzmann Simulation Studies (5 papers), Fluid Dynamics and Turbulent Flows (4 papers), Heat Transfer and Optimization (4 papers), Particle Dynamics in Fluid Flows (3 papers), Wind and Air Flow Studies (2 papers), Nanofluid Flow and Heat Transfer (2 papers) and Heat Transfer Mechanisms (2 papers). The work is most often cited by research in Computational Mechanics (254 citations), Mechanical Engineering (179 citations), Biomedical Engineering (212 citations), Fluid Flow and Transfer Processes (20 citations) and Ocean Engineering (48 citations). A. Dybbs has collaborated with scholars based in United States and Israel. Frequent co-authors include Jiazhen Ling, Kamal K. Kar, William Johnston, George Ś. Springer, R. E. Sonntag, Gordon John Van Wylen, F. A. Lyman, Kaufui V. Wong, R. V. Edwards and Eli Reshotko. Their work appears in journals such as International Journal of Heat and Mass Transfer, Journal of Heat Transfer, Journal of Hydrology, Journal of Applied Mechanics and Journal of Spacecraft and Rockets.
